Pat (Patsy) Hammond, Principal
Pat Hammond is
a broadly skilled human resources consultant with global experience. She is a skilled facilitator, a business problem solver,
a performance focused executive coach, and a creative career strategist. Pat is a trainer and facilitator across a broad range
of HR topics such as managing change, team building, work/life programming, delivering quality customer service, and performance
management. Pat provides value-added consulting services to companies looking to attract and retain talent and to increase
productivity through work/life programming. Pat counsels senior managers to increase their effectiveness and productivity
on the job. She also works with private clients to assess their skills and interests, in preparing resumes, and in job search
strategies. Prior to forming her firm in 2002, Work Life Management, LLC, Pat worked for J.P. Morgan for 21 years. Throughout
her career there, Pat’s positions included manager of work/life programming, Internet recruiting leader, employee relations
specialist, and human resources generalist.Pat graduated from Duke University in Durham, North Carolina and has a certificate
from NYU’s Adult Career Planning and Development program. She is qualified in Myers Briggs. Pat is a member of the Arthritis
Foundation’s Board of Directors and the Patient Services Committee, is on the Executive Committee of the Alumni Board for
Duke University, and is a member of the Junior League of Summit, New Jersey. Pat is member of the Society for Human Resource
Management (SHRM), the Association of Work Life Professionals (AWLP) and the Association of Career Professionals (ACP). She
and her husband and daughter live in Summit, New Jersey.
